Numeric input
The numeric input method allows you to use the alphanumeric keys
to enter numbers.
Entering symbols
To open the symbol table, press . Press again to open the
next page. Scroll to highlight the desired symbol. Press to place the
symbol in the text.
Bluetooth and USB connections
Bluetooth
Your phone features Bluetooth technology which allows you to have a
wireless connection between your phone and your Bluetooth devices.
Adding a Bluetooth device to your phone
1. If you go to Tools > Connection > Bluetooth > Turn On to turn on
Bluetooth, you will be asked to search for and add Bluetooth devices.
Press (Ye s ) to begin searching.
2. Alternatively, you can go toTools > Connection > Bluetooth > Add
Device. The phone then begins searching.
3. When a list of available devices appears on the screen, select a device to
connect to and press .
4. When a message appears asking for your permission to connect to this
device, press (Ye s ) to connect.
5. Enter the passkey for the device, both in the phone and in the device
that you are connecting to.
6. When the passkey is accepted, the device is paired.
